AI Summary

Stove Works is a nonprofit organization dedicated to arts education, education, and the promotion of arts and culture. Its mission is to provide space, support services, and educational programming through the exhibition of contemporary art that is open and free to the public. With an operating budget of $336.8K and total revenue of $315.6K for the 2024 fiscal year, Stove Works relies on significant support from funders such as AMERICAN ENDOWMENT FOUNDATION and THE COMMUNITY FOUNDATION FOR GREATER ATLANTA INC, but does not depend on any single funder for 50% or more of its revenue.

Mission Statement

Providing space, supporting services, and education programming for and through exhibition of contemporary art open & free to the public.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is Stove Works’s budget?
In 2024, Stove Works reported an annual operating budget of around $337 thousand. More detailed financial information is available to registered users.
What causes does Stove Works support?
Stove Works supports work in Education, Arts education, and Arts and culture.
Where does Stove Works operate?
Stove Works is headquartered in Chattanooga, TN.
